Use the hosted Explorer link. It opens the corpus overview without hydrating every work or provision.
The overview establishes the corpus boundary: legal-work count, official manifestation count, represented years, document types, categories and current source notices.
Find legislation
- Search for an exact title, citation, year or distinctive phrase.
- Use Category, Document Type, Creation Year and Jurisdiction to reduce ambiguous results.
- Treat Topic as a discovery aid only; it is inferred from titles.
- Select the exact work, checking type code, year, number and jurisdiction.
- Open the official work if the result could be confused with a commencement, amendment or remedial instrument.
Local title search is combined with the official legislation.gov.uk full-text Atom search. Results identify whether they came from the static pack or the live official search.
Find and cite a provision
- Open a work's detail card.
- Review the official identifier, document type, category, year/number, jurisdiction, legal-status note and manifestations.
- Select Load every Part, Chapter, section, article and nested provision.
- Search within the instrument for a section number or phrase.
- Use Selected passage to open the official pinpoint URL.
- Use Copy provenance citation as the starting point for a citation ledger.
- Separately check version, commencement, extent, amendments and unapplied effects.
Minimum evidence for an answer
Every material proposition should record:
- the source title;
- the direct selected-passage URL;
- the text or faithful paraphrase supporting the proposition;
- version or point-in-time context;
- commencement and extent context where material;
- retrieval date;
- any unresolved amendment, interpretation or missing-fact issue.
An Act landing page on its own is not pinpoint provenance. A catalogue result on its own is not the law.
